Tucked beneath 600 F St NW, Denson Liquor Bar is a subterranean cocktail lounge that channels 1920s Art Deco elegance. Accessed via stairs on 6th St NW, just across from the fire station, the space features deep leather booths and a refined ambiance. The menu boasts classic cocktails like the Aviation and Hemingway daiquiri, alongside an extensive whiskey selection emphasizing American and Scottish bottles. For a light bite, the grilled cheese with a sweet fig twist is a standout. Reservations are available for booths with a two-hour limit; bar seating operates on a first-come, first-served basis. The venue is strictly 21 and up, with a business casual dress code. Notably, Denson Liquor Bar has been recognized by Architectural Digest and Washington City Paper for its sophisticated design and ambiance.
